Why is this hard to memorize?
Functional groups are the heart of organic chemistry — they determine reactivity, naming, and properties. For NEET and JEE, you need to know the priority order (for IUPAC naming), structures, and typical reactions of each group. The priority order from highest to lowest is: –COOH > –SO₃H > –COOR > –COX > –CONH₂ > –CHO > –CO– > –OH > –NH₂ > –C≡C– > –C=C–. Getting this priority wrong means wrong IUPAC names on the exam. A mnemonic that captures both the group and its rank is invaluable.
Classic mnemonics you should know
"COOH Sochta hai COOR Kya CONH₂ CHO CO OH NH₂ Triple Double"
Read in order: Carboxylic acid → Sulphonic acid → Ester → Acid halide → Amide → Aldehyde → Ketone → Alcohol → Amine → Alkyne → Alkene. The Hindi "Sochta hai Kya" (thinks what) connects them.
"Camels Seldom Eat At Ample Afternoon Kitchen — Only Active Troops Dance"
C(Camels/COOH) → Carboxylic acid, S(Seldom/SO₃H) → Sulphonic acid, E(Eat/COOR) → Ester, A(At/COX) → Acid halide, A(Ample/CONH₂) → Amide, A(Afternoon/CHO) → Aldehyde, K(Kitchen/CO) → Ketone, O(Only/OH) → Alcohol, A(Active/NH₂) → Amine, T(Troops/≡) → Alkyne, D(Dance/=) → Alkene.
"Acids Sulph Esters Halides Amides Aldehydes Ketones Alcohols Amines Triple Double"
Just say the group names in order. After a few repetitions, the sequence becomes automatic. Focus on the first letter pattern: A-S-E-H-Am-Al-K-Al-Am-T-D.
The complete list
- Carboxylic acid (–COOH)
- Sulphonic acid (–SO₃H)
- Ester (–COOR)
- Acid halide (–COX)
- Amide (–CONH₂)
- Aldehyde (–CHO)
- Ketone (–CO–)
- Alcohol (–OH)
- Amine (–NH₂)
- Alkyne (–C≡C–)
- Alkene (–C=C–)
Frequently asked questions
Why is the priority order of functional groups important?
In IUPAC naming, the highest-priority functional group becomes the principal characteristic group (suffix). Lower-priority groups become prefixes. Getting the order wrong gives a completely wrong IUPAC name — which costs marks in NEET and JEE.
How do I remember that –COOH is highest priority?
Think of –COOH as the "king" of functional groups — it contains both C=O and O–H, making it the most oxidized organic functional group. Everything else is derived by reducing or modifying it. Carboxylic acid → Ester → Amide → Aldehyde → Ketone → Alcohol.
What happens when a compound has two functional groups of equal priority?
If a compound has two identical groups (e.g., two –COOH), the name uses "di-" prefix (e.g., "dioic acid"). If they are different but equal priority (rare), follow IUPAC alphabetical convention rules, though this is uncommon in exams.
